Large shop approx 1,700 sq.ft workshop & residence on 5.12 acres makes this one of those great properties that allow all kinds of uses. The property is currently un-zoned which allows for multiple residences as well as many other possibilities. The Modular home has a great open floor plan with 3 good size bedrooms & 2 full baths. This sunny spot has plenty of room for all sorts of parking, gardening even outdoor activities. Other features include; access from two highways, a good private well, and a level acreage. The shop has been completely updated and upgraded even with a new garage door. Endless ideas with this rare find!
